Output 8423defb1f50b21968ccef28b3cf8f36f8acb812b27963de7d8ec9461a92e8d4:0

value
16685
script pubkey
OP_0 OP_PUSHBYTES_20 731040f029151d5caebc7149b63b99ebd7809014
address
bc1qwvgypupfz5w4et4uw9ymvwuea0tcpyq54xksq5
transaction
8423defb1f50b21968ccef28b3cf8f36f8acb812b27963de7d8ec9461a92e8d4
confirmations
169502
spent
true